WebA rick of wood is an informal measure of firewood, and it’s typically 1/3 the size of a cord. A typical rick would be a stack of wood measuring 4 ft. WebMar 22, 2024 · The Brikawood home is unique in a variety of ways, but is particularly notworthy in its low-energy footprint, reducing its environmental impact. The materials used have all been approved and certified for use in passive house construction, and includes the use of certified windows and insulation that provide substantial benefit.
